Preceptor Miriam is a enemy Invader in Elden Ring. Preceptor Miriam can be found inside Carian Study Hall. They wear a large wide-brimmed hat and use a staff to cast many types of sorceries at their enemies.

One of the magic preceptors that served the Carian royals

Preceptor Miriam Notes & Tips

  • Preceptor Miriam teleports further up the tower as she takes damage. The summons that accompany Miriam can be triggered early by running past where she first appears and up the tower. This allows you to take them out without much risk and makes confronting Miriam much safer.
    • When Miriam gets to the top level with the ladder, she will keep teleporting non stop when you get close to her. Climbing the ladder to the rafters above her seems to cause her to switch weapons and stop her from teleporting, even if you go back down.
  • Miriam will not cast spells nor teleport away from you if you are standing in the small room at the top of the second elevator. Using a ranged weapon from this position will trivialize this section of the encounter.
  • She can be thrown out using the Ash of War Stamp (Upward Cut) near the railings. The fall will kill her instantly.
  • Preceptor Miriam is extremely susceptible to Glintstone Blade.
    • At the beginning when she first appears, charge up as many as you can and they will hit her and force her to teleport to zone two.
    • Go up and get her to spawn a second time and you can use the corner of the wall before the bridge to block her shots while firing at her when she gets close since Glintstone Blade fires over the railing. There is a chance she won't come close enough to hit her.
    • The same can be done at the top level. She will generally attempt to maintain a safe distance from you, but within range of your spell. The circular railing will create a barrier to block her shots and let you fire over the top at her with Glintstone Blade.
    • Phase two and three should be doable in a similar fashion with any ranged weapon that can hit her at that distance. While slightly more risky, you can strafe out from behind the barrier and fire between her spells as they have long casting periods or short range.
  • Fight with Miriam can be easily won by forcing her to come down to the floor with the Study Hall Entrance site of grace, and then riding up with the elevator. While trying to attack the player, she should then fall into the elevator's hole.
  • The second iteration of Miriam is very vulnerable to sorcery, particularly Loretta's Greatbow. Due to the elevation advantage against her in most of the inverted fight, you fire at her and she will hit the platform while you strike her with relative impunity. Other spells or ranged weapons will likely work, too.
  • Miriam's casting will be interrupted by a the Mighty Shot skill, allowing you to kill her easily.

Preceptor Miriam Lore

Telescope

Astrology tool used by members of the Carian royal family. 'A stolen part of a larger instrument.

Allows the viewer to better see faraway things.

During the age of the Erdtree, Carian astrology withered on the vine. 'The fate once writ in the night skies had been fettered by the Golden Order.

Preceptor's Big Hat

Large hat with the movements of the stars drawn on the inside of the brim. Worn by the magic preceptors who served the Carian royals.

Increases mind to the detriment of stamina.

Glintstone sorcerers are the descendants of astrologers, a fact that the Carians remain of aware of. Even if their fate has been long severed from the stars.

Mask of Confidence

Mask with the mouth sewn shut with gold thread.

Increases arcane.

When Radagon married Rennala, he ordered the Carian magic preceptors to don these masks. To make it clear that all of their matters were to be kept strictly private.

Preceptor's Long Gown

A long, bright blue gown with the movements of the stars drawn upon it. Worn by the magic preceptors who served the Carian royals.

Glintstone sorcerers are the descendants of astrologers, a fact that the Carians remain aware of. Even if their fate has been long severed from the stars.

Loretta's Greatbow

Sorcery used by Royal Knight Loretta.

Creates a magic greatbow and fires a great arrow. Charging enhances potency. Hold to keep the great arrow nocked.

It is said that the bow was Loretta's favored weapon.

Miriam's Vanishing

Sorcery of a preceptor who served the Carian royal family.

Used to conceal oneself in a glintstone haze, reappearing after a few seconds have passed. Directional inputs determine where one will reappear.

The curator of the study hall was such a master of this sorcery that it now bears her name.
